Context: The Unaudited Ledger
Traditional equity compensation is a black box. The AFL-CIO calculates Musk's 2025 compensation using the grant-date fair value of restricted stock units—a GAAP-mandated estimate that assumes future stock price performance. But the actual value when Musk sells? Nobody knows until the 10-K drops. The 2018 performance award, which this $158.3B figure derives from, was tied to 12 tranches of market cap and revenue milestones. Tesla shareholders re-approved it in June 2024 with 72% support, yet the Delaware Chancery Court still invalidated the original grant. The case now sits with the state Supreme Court.

Core: What On-Chain Compensation Would Reveal
If Tesla had issued Musk's compensation as a tokenized smart contract on Ethereum (or its own L2), the data would answer three questions the AFL-CIO report cannot:
- Real-time dilution impact: The $158.3B represents roughly 5-8% of Tesla's market cap. On-chain, every vesting event would mint new tokens, instantly reflected in the circulating supply. Traditional equity vesting is opaque—shares are held in treasury, diluted over years, and only reported quarterly. A smart contract would show the exact dilution schedule, allowing holders to model their exact ownership decay. - Conditional milestone verification: The 2018 award had 12 market cap and revenue targets. On-chain, an oracle (e.g., Chainlink) could feed Tesla's reported revenue and market cap into the smart contract, automatically unlocking tranches when conditions are met. No court battles over whether the board's process was flawed. No subjective interpretation of "substantial achievement." The code is the contract. Contrarian: Correlation ≠ Causation, and Transparency ≠ Fairness
Before we canonize on-chain compensation, let's audit the counterarguments. The crypto industry is not exactly a paragon of equitable pay. According to AFL-CIO's own data, the S&P 500 CEO-to-median-worker pay ratio sits at 312x. In crypto, the gap is arguably worse—founders and early investors hold tokens that appreciate by orders of magnitude, while employees often receive options that expire worthless. The "transparency" of on-chain compensation doesn't automatically make it fair. It just makes it visible.
More importantly, the $158.3B figure is a static snapshot. If Tesla's stock price drops 50% by 2028, the actual value of Musk's award could be $79B—still massive, but not the headline number. The AFL-CIO's framing uses grant-date fair value, which is a GAAP estimate, not a realized cash flow. On-chain, the same volatility exists. A token price crash could render a compensation plan worthless, just as a stock crash does. The difference is that tokenized compensation is more liquid—Musk could sell tokens immediately upon vesting, whereas equity has lock-up periods. That liquidity could actually increase the risk of founder extraction, not reduce it.
